Output 236432042b5d8c1898a967f768e49f6590d593d950961b1824adf22c06e8d8ad:1

value
462310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ba83a589c820f375f7b9b556279e1857e44c3dcc OP_EQUAL
address
3JhDKC8QdGyMiHGWHK1HBywz8CxLg33ufB
transaction
236432042b5d8c1898a967f768e49f6590d593d950961b1824adf22c06e8d8ad
spent
true